Depth of Extinction | Ancient Frontier: Steel Shadows | |
|---|---|---|
| Released | 2018 | 2018 |
| Genres | Strategy, Indie, RPG | Strategy |
| Platforms | Windows, macOS, Linux | Windows |
| Steam Deck | Unrated | Unrated |
| Price | 14.99 USD | 14.99 USD |
| Steam reviews | 73.8% positive (141 reviews) | 68% positive (25 reviews) |
| Multiplayer | Single-player only | Single-player only |
| Developers | HOF Studios | Fair Weather Studios |
